Web intelligence
Important SEO Techniques

Search engine optimisation starts with useful content that people can find, read and navigate. The practical priorities are to answer a clear question, make important pages accessible to crawlers, connect related information and remove obstacles for visitors. Work on these foundations before adjusting minor details or chasing isolated ranking changes.
Begin with one important page. Record its purpose, existing search traffic and any technical problems, then choose a focused improvement. A documented change gives you something to evaluate; a wholesale rewrite combined with a redesign makes the results harder to interpret.
Match the page to the reader’s task
A keyword describes a subject, but it may not explain what the reader needs. Someone searching for website maintenance might want a checklist, a fault diagnosis or help planning routine work. Decide which task your page serves before choosing its headings.
Write a short brief identifying the reader, their question and what they should understand afterwards. For a troubleshooting page, include symptoms, checks and possible remedies. For a comparison, explain the criteria and trade-offs. Avoid an opening that defines the whole subject when the reader needs a specific answer.
Use the vocabulary readers recognise, including necessary technical terms with short explanations. Do not repeat a target phrase in every heading or add awkward variations to meet a keyword count. Read the copy aloud: if the wording sounds forced, simplify it.
Make each page useful and distinct
Put the central answer near the beginning, then supply the detail needed to apply it. Replace broad advice such as “improve your website” with a concrete check: open the navigation on a narrow screen and confirm that every menu item remains reachable.
Use descriptive subheadings, short paragraphs and lists for genuine sequences or alternatives. Explain limitations where they affect a decision. A recommendation without its conditions can be misleading, even when it sounds plausible.
Before creating another page, check whether an existing one already answers the same question. Improve incomplete coverage instead of publishing several near-identical articles. When reviewing older content, correct errors and remove obsolete instructions. Preserve useful detail rather than shortening a page solely to reach an arbitrary length.
Support consequential claims with appropriate references. Cite the material that supports the statement, rather than attaching unrelated links to make the page look researched. Separate factual guidance from your own suggested workflow, and never invent experience, endorsements or results.
Write clear titles and headings
Give each page a descriptive title that distinguishes it from neighbouring pages. “Website maintenance checklist for a small publication” tells readers more than “Essential guide”. The main heading should accurately describe the content that follows, without promising a scope the page does not cover.
Write a concise page description that summarises its value in plain language. Avoid repeating the same description across unrelated pages. Search listings may display different text, so treat the description as useful metadata rather than a guaranteed message.
Organise subheadings around the reader’s questions. A troubleshooting article might move from identifying the symptom to checking access and testing a fix. Do not use headings merely to repeat search phrases; their first job is to make the document easy to scan.
Connect pages through ordinary links
Important pages should be reachable through navigation or contextual links. A page that appears only in a sitemap may remain difficult for visitors to find. Review your main categories and check that they lead to the most useful supporting material.
Use ordinary HTML links with a destination in the href attribute. Choose anchor text that explains the destination, such as “image compression checklist”, instead of “click here”. Add a link where the reader needs the next explanation, not wherever another keyword appears.
Check links after moving or editing content. Repair broken destinations and avoid sending readers through unnecessary redirects. Keep established URLs stable: changing a working address for cosmetic reasons can disrupt bookmarks and incoming links without improving the answer.
Check crawling and indexing controls
Discovery, crawling and indexing are separate steps. A search engine may know a URL exists but be unable to retrieve it, or retrieve a page without including it in search results. Diagnose the specific obstacle before rewriting the content.
- Response: confirm that the intended page loads successfully and does not return an error or an unrelated redirect.
- Access: check whether crawler rules accidentally block important public pages or resources.
- Indexing: inspect the page for an unintended noindex instruction.
- Duplication: review canonical settings where several addresses represent substantially the same content.
- Discovery: include intended public pages in a maintained sitemap and connect them through internal links.
A sitemap helps describe available URLs; it does not guarantee indexing. Likewise, a crawler exclusion is not a reliable way to keep sensitive information private. Private content needs proper access controls rather than a request that automated visitors stay away.
Use structured data only when it accurately describes information visible on the page. Do not add invented reviews, ratings or relationships. Validate the markup and correct errors, while recognising that valid markup does not guarantee an enhanced search appearance.
Test the experience visitors receive
Open the page on a small screen and navigate it with a keyboard. Check text size, contrast, focus visibility and whether menus obscure the main content. Important information should not depend on hovering over an element. Give meaningful images appropriate alternative text.
Investigate slow pages by looking for oversized images, unnecessary scripts and excessive requests. Resize assets to suit their display dimensions and remove unused resources. Measure before and after a change so that a perceived improvement is supported by evidence.
Test actual tasks as well as loading speed. Can a reader follow a related link, download a document or complete an available form? Check error messages and empty states. A fast page that prevents the visitor from finishing their task still needs repair.
Check more than the homepage. Sample an article, a category page and any page with a different layout. Shared navigation may work everywhere while a particular template has clipped headings, missing images or controls that cannot receive keyboard focus.
Measure a focused change
Record a baseline for the page: search impressions, clicks, relevant queries and meaningful visitor actions where measurement is available. These answer different questions. More impressions may indicate broader visibility without showing that the page satisfies the people who reach it.
Keep a dated change log describing what you edited and why. Compare equivalent periods where possible, noting seasonal demand or other site changes that could affect the result. Avoid treating a brief movement in ranking as proof that one edit succeeded or failed.
Combine measurement with inspection. Read the page as a first-time visitor and check whether its title, opening answer and linked destinations agree. Use the next review to resolve a specific remaining problem, such as an unanswered question or a broken navigation path.
